SOCIAL AND PERSONAL
Mr Reg. Morgan, programme organiser of IYA (better known as “Uncle Beg.”) is staying with Mr and Mrs Maborlv for a few days.
The Mayor and Mrs C. H. Priestley arid Miss J. Priestley, who have been spending several days in Auckland, returned home yesterday.
Miss D. Spooner, of Palmerston North, and formerly of Cambridge, is spending the week-end here with friends. On Tuesday she will go on to Auckland to take up her new appointment as matron of tire Methodist Children’s Home at Epsom.
